    Just watched the movie and thought it was great. I'm also a huge Gran Turismo fan for mamy years now so it was up my alley.
    The obe thing though, Gran Turismo isn't a proper Sim Racer as it tries to make you believe. It's a so-called SimCade Racer. (A hybrid between simulation and arcade).
    The difference is that it tries to be realistic as possible yet easy enough to puck up and play even with a cotnroller. So the cars don't really behave like real cars, the driving physics aren't geared to be hyper realistic. Forzs Motorsport would also fall under the SimCade genre.
    But we got a lot of great SimRacers thst are even more realistic than GT the mast few years.
    Games like Assetto Corsa Competizione, rFactor 2, AutoMobilista 2 and iRacing but these are mainly PC Games.
